Beautiful ship, Ok food, entertainment severely lacking, expensive,

Review for a Mediterranean Cruise on Costa Smeralda

User Avatar
lizhos
2-5 Cruises • Age 50s

The ship is beautiful. New, lots of bars, modern and clean. Plus the port stop offs are lovely. Plenty of time to walk around. We do recommend purchasing shuttle buses at the port information desks rather than on ship as way cheaper. No need to pay for excursions, just the shuttle buses into the cities needed and you can find your own way around. The staff work hard and are helpful. Our room ...
